List Price: $11.98 Price: $7.97 You Save: $4.01 (33%) 23 used & new from $7.41 “We wanted a tough album,” producer Quincy Jones recalls in a bonus interview on this special edition of Bad . Though the 1987 blockbuster would appear to be Michael Jackson’s most personal statement to date–9 of its 11 cuts were written solely by him–its appeal also rested more on craft than the idiosyncratic art of Thriller and Off the Wall . List Price: $11.98 Price: $7.97 You Save: $4.01 (33%) 31 used & new from $6.55 Given the pace of Michael Jackson’s post- Thriller release schedule, it’s striking that Off the Wall appeared between two albums with his brothers, Destiny (1978) and Triumph (1980), on which the twentysomething phenomenon was also fully engaged. Aided by richly detailed but not overdone production, Off the Wall redefined how much Michael might do.
